Virtual Press room

How do you help your local journalists get the information that they need to write their stories on your issues? Have a press conference? What if nobody turns up because there is a major news story breaking at that scheduled time?
To manage your time better and to be helpful to your media outlets set up a Virtual Pressroom within your website.

Alan Rosenblatt of the Internet Advocacy Centre writes in Politics Online

A Virtual Pressroom is a media-facing website that provides a wide range of resources to the media for their coverage of your issue or candidate. It is a chance to cast these resources within the narrative you want to see in the press. It is a way to provide background for news stories, publishable photos and graphics, video clips, press contacts, and opportunities for setting up expert interviews and make it available to the press 24/7, online.

A good Virtual Pressroom needs to be an authoritative website. While it may have a point of view, it should present well-evidenced information, opposing views, and opportunities to learn more—to dig deeper into the subject.


Then, let the press know about your site. Encourage them to visit it and drink in the information. Sure, they will still call you, but for fewer reasons and hopefully during business hours. And Virtual Pressrooms are a non-addictive prescription for sleeplessness.
